WebHeparin is used to prevent blood clots from forming in people who have certain medical conditions or who are undergoing certain medical procedures that increase the chance … WebHow much volume will you draw-up? To administer 5000 units of heparin using 10000 unit/2ml ampules, we can use a proportion: 10000 units in 2 ml 5000 units in x ml. x = (5000 units x 2 ml) / 10000 units x = 1 ml. Therefore, 1 ml of the heparin solution needs to be drawn-up to administer 5000 units of heparin via subcutaneous injection. 3. how can trauma result from genocide

WebSep 7, 2024 · In general, weight based nomograms are much more likely to achieve therapeutic levels within 48 hours. It is important to note that the most critical factor in reducing the risk of recurrent thromboembolism is reaching a therapeutic PTT within 24-48 hours. Heparin . ICD 10 code: N18.6, End-Stage Renal Disease . Purpose: To provide optimal management of anticoagulation for in-center hemodialysis patients through the use of heparin. Heparin Dosing: By bolus. Initial Heparin dose per physician order using heparin 1,000 units/ml vial. 1. Maximum initial bolus 8000 units. 2.

WebThe most Heparin Lock Flush a child should get in one day (24 hours) is 40 units per kilogram (kg) of the child’s weight. Too much heparin in a 24-hour period can cause the blood to become too thin, which can lead to bleeding problems. To find out how much Heparin Lock Flush a child can get in a day, multiply 40 times the child’s weight in ... WebThe cost for heparin intravenous solution (50 units/mL-NaCl 0.45%) is around $164 for a supply of 12000 milliliters, depending on the pharmacy you visit. Quoted prices are for cash-paying customers and are not valid with insurance plans. The port is then flushed with 3 ml of Heparin (100 units/ml) after the completion of IV medication doses (no more frequently than every 4 hours & prior to the removal of the needle) and/or monthly when the port is not in use.
